GDPR - A Year in the Chair

Overview
A 6-module decision-based scenario course following a single in-house counsel / DPO across a year of GDPR exposure: an Article 15 SAR including audio recordings, a 72-hour breach notification, RoPA hygiene, an international transfer dilemma, a consent trap, and a supervisory authority hearing. Approximately 165 minutes total. Course delivered in English; covers the EU GDPR (Regulation (EU) 2016/679).

Learning Objectives:
- Fulfil an Article 15 subject access request (including audio recordings) within statutory windows
- File a 72-hour breach notification meeting Article 33 standards
- Maintain an Article 30 record of processing activities
- Navigate Chapter V international transfer obligations post-Schrems II
- Recognise consent traps and apply the Article 7 conditions
- Engage with a supervisory authority during examination
